John was born on 24 January 1579 at Wollaston, Northamptonshire,{source needed} the son of John Neyll of Yelden in Com. Bedford and of Wollaston in com. Northampton and of Grace dau of John Buttler of Cotkenles in Com. Pembroke.[1] This 1579 birth date looks suspect given he married in 1593 and his wife was born in 1565.
He married Elizabeth FitzGeoffrey in Milton Ernest, Bedfordshire on 17 Dec 1593, "Gentleman"[2][3] Yet the Visitation shows his wife as the daughter of George FitzGeoffrey of Crekers (Barford)
His first wife must have died for he married Elizabeth Conquest, daughter of Sir Richard Conquest, in Houghton Conquest, Bedfordshire on 12 Dec 1599[4] John Neale, Gentleman, in Houghton Conquest baptised two children there, Edmund 11 January 1600/01 born 6 January, and Elizabeth 4 March 1601/02 born 27 February.[5][6]
VCH Wollaston has this to say about John Neale - In 1564 the rectory was bestowed by Queen Elizabeth on George Carleton, who sold it in 1581 to John Neale.this must have been John's father. In 1594 Neale, as proprietary rector of the church, this was probably the son, after marrying Elizabeth FitzGeoffrey reported that the chancel was very ruinous and almost falling, so that it was 'of no use either to the church or the inhabitants, and moreover cannot be repaired except at great cost, therefore he desires to be relieved of the obligation'. John Neale's descendants remained in possession for over a hundred years. He with his second wife Elizabeth and Edmund Neale, who was perhaps their son, dealt with the rectory by fine in 1623 and again in 1633. Edmund Neale died in 1671[7]
He passed away in 1656.{source required} There's no such burial in Houghton Conquest parish register.
What's the evidence that it was John Neale from Wollaston, Northants, who had a daughter in Neunhan Pardox, Worcs, and who died in Houghton Conquest, Beds? She wasn't born in Neunhan Pardox - that was where her alleged husband was from.
Can anyone show me exactly where Neunhan Pardox is in Worcestershire? Or even in England? A google search only finds references in connection with the Fielding family. The positive news is that John and Elizabeth (Conquest) are shown in the Visitation as having a daughter Elizabeth. All that's needed now is to link her to Richard Fielding. And to find the mythical Neunhan Pardox! (later - it's actually the hamlet of Newnham Paddox, in the parish of Monks Kirby, in the county of Warwickshire.)
